We are looking for a Centralized Risk Supervisor within our Wealth Advice Solutions Risk & Governance (WAS R&G) organization to perform supervisory-related functions and controls based on the activities performed by registered representatives at Schwab with a focus on Advisory Services. This Centralized Risk Supervisor will play a key role in contributing to supervisory program reviews of electronic communications, fixed income product/service recommendations, trading activity, trend reporting and desktop procedures updates. This is an individual contributor role in which you’ll collaborate with business partners across the firm, building effective working relationships with various levels of WAS employees from client-facing representatives to Senior Leadership.
